Do I need an active Veda membership to use saved widgets?
Yes. An active eligible Veda membership is required to create, update, and use saved Veda Widgets.
What happens to an embedded widget if I delete the saved widget?
The old embed will no longer display the widget. Instead, it will show a message that the Veda Virtual widget is no longer available.
Does deleting a widget free up a widget spot?
Yes. Deleting a saved widget reduces your saved widget count and frees that spot for another widget.
Can I delete a saved widget?
Yes. Go to My Widgets and select Delete next to the widget you no longer need.
What are Veda Widgets?
Veda Widgets are interactive tools you can create, customize, save, and embed inside your virtual spaces. Different widget types are designed for different jobs, such as audio, message boards, room information, and other interactive features.
Can I resize a widget after I embed it?
Yes. Veda widget embed code is designed to fill the space where you place it, so you can size the embed within your virtual room or other supported platform without creating a new widget.
How do I get the embed code for a widget?
Go to My Widgets and select Copy Code next to the saved widget. Paste that code into a location that accepts iframe embeds.
Do I need to replace the embed code after editing a widget?
No. Your saved widget keeps the same embed code when you edit it. Changes you save are reflected in the widget anywhere that code is already embedded.
How do I edit a saved widget?
Go to My Widgets and select Edit next to the widget. This takes you back to that widget’s generator with your saved settings loaded.
Does editing a widget use another widget spot?
No. Editing an existing saved widget updates that widget and does not use another widget spot.
